JSP 导出Excel表格的实例

模板素材 2025-05-14 23:05www.dzhlxh.cn模板素材

在Java后台中,我们通常会返回一个ModelAndView对象。为了实现导出功能,我们添加以下两行设置到响应头中:

response.setContentType("application/vnd.ms-excel");

response.setHeader("Content-disposition","attachment;filename=" + URLEncoder.encode("会员列表.xls", "UTF-8"));

这两行代码的作用是设定响应的内容类型为Excel格式,并设置响应头为附件形式,以便浏览器能够识别并弹出下载对话框。文件名被设定为“会员列表.xls”,确保用户能够清晰地知道下载的文件内容。

同样的设置也可以直接在JSP页面中进行。在JSP页面的开头部分,我们可以添加以下代码:

<%@ page language="java" import="java.util." pageEncoding="UTF-8"%>

<%@ taglib prefix="c" uri=" %>

<%

response.setContentType("application/vnd.ms-excel");

response.setHeader("Content-disposition","attachment;filename=" + java.URLEncoder.encode("会员列表.xls", "UTF-8"));

%>

Copyright © 2016-2025 www.dzhlxh.cn 金源码 版权所有 Power by

网站模板下载|网络推广|微博营销|seo优化|视频营销|网络营销|微信营销|网站建设|织梦模板|小程序模板